The Routes
This 50km ride starts at the K&P parking lot on Unity Road, just west of Cordukes and travels west to Odessa. The ride will then turn north and east towards Harrowsmith and Sydenham. It will return via Stage Coach Road and Hwy 9 to Unity and the parking lot.

Safety/Ride Preparation
Safety Matters
Please familiarize yourself with everything under the "Safety Matters" tab
Lights
Always use front and rear lights with daytime flashing modes
Group Riding
Communicate your movements (including speed changes) and any obstacles
No Wheel Overlapping
Just don't do it!
Passing
Always on the left, and call it out (typically, “on your left”)
Traffic Laws
Obey them!
Things to Bring
cell phone (if available), with the app "what3words" installed
copy of the ride route (downloaded to a mobile device or printed)
spare tube, pump and tool kit
sufficient hydration and nutrition
health card and document showing address and emergency contact information
